CHANGELOG — Ladlefork 2.9. Heads up: we renamed SCALE_API_TOKEN to PORTION_SERVICE_TOKEN since the scaling math moved to the portion service. The old name is ignored as of this release, no fallback, so the calculator will 401 on unit conversions until you update. Fix is quick — drop this line into the service env file:

env line for fafof-fahag: LEDGER_TOKEN5=f8790

## Deployment

The Splitfin assignment service must be deployed before any experiment-consuming services, since assignments are cached downstream for up to an hour. Always deploy to the shadow environment first and compare assignment distributions against the previous build; a skew above 0.5% blocks promotion. Once parity is confirmed, roll out with the production configuration given below.

settings of fafog-haduf:
ZORIX_PIN=4648
ZORIX_METRICS_HOST=metrics.zorix.paliqsys.corp
ZORIX_LOG_LEVEL=info
ZORIX_TENANT=druix

## Deployment

The Ferngate flag-rollout framework deploys as a sidecar alongside each consuming service. Order matters: the evaluation daemon must be healthy before the main container starts, or flags silently fall back to defaults — a failure mode that has bitten us twice. Always verify the readiness probe before promoting a release. The sidecar reads its settings at boot; the canonical values are:

config for tagep-yajef:
ulawyn:
  log_level: error
  metrics_host: metrics.ulawyn.lumiclabs.internal
  pin: 0564
  pool_size: 32

**Checklist: Address autocomplete widget (Dovekey)**

Hey, welcome aboard — before we ship, make sure the Dovekey autocomplete widget handles slow network gracefully (spinner, no frozen dropdown), respects the max-suggestion cap of eight, and falls back to manual entry when the suggestion service times out. Also poke at apartment-number edge cases; they bit us last release. Test against the staging build tagged with the token below.

session token of tajef-bageg = htk21_5d90d574934f3ccae6437